Transaction 70cc99485acc564cd098de368f82a2a43292f3ca077616851c3e7e004bfd3e23

1 Input
2 Outputs
  • 70cc99485acc564cd098de368f82a2a43292f3ca077616851c3e7e004bfd3e23:0
  • value  16610000
    address  1E5cVQPUb3Pqw54ph2vJ259Mb3GpTQYuhn
  • 70cc99485acc564cd098de368f82a2a43292f3ca077616851c3e7e004bfd3e23:1
  • value  66841100
    address  1JbmKLvmz5PWu9hJdtYXJdbUcE9abkN5xy